Keonte A. Cook, a 19-year-old African American male from Joliet, Illinois, was tragically shot and killed in the early hours of May 11, 2018. The incident occurred in the 1400 block of North Center Street, a location known for its rough surroundings. Cook was pronounced dead at 2:58 a.m. after suffering a fatal gunshot wound to the head. The Will County Coroner's Office confirmed that his death was being treated as a homicide.
